— The Washington Post is reporting that Connecticut Sen. Chris Dodd (D) will not seek re-election. Richard Blumenthal, the state’s popular attorney general, will likely run for his seat now. This may be bad news for Linda McMahon. Connecticut is Democratic state, but Dodd was not that popular in the state, and many felt that this year a Republican candidate would win.
